From Welcome Offers to Strategic Acquisition Tools
Historically, online casinos relied heavily on simple welcome bonuses—often matching a player’s initial deposit—as primary customer incentives. However, as markets saturated and regulatory scrutiny increased, operators shifted towards more nuanced strategies, including no-deposit bonuses, free spins, and loyalty programs. This evolution reflects a deeper understanding of consumer psychology and the necessity for sustainable customer acquisition models.

Legal and Ethical Considerations
With regulatory bodies increasingly scrutinising bonus offerings—particularly concerning transparency and responsible gambling—operators must adapt to compliance standards while maintaining competitive advantages. This has led to innovations such as targeted bonus campaigns, partial wagering requirements, and detailed terms that ensure fair play and foster trust. Notably, the UK Gambling Commission emphasizes the importance of clear communication about bonus conditions, setting a high bar for operational integrity.
